Найти в Дзене

26 Настройка узла управления Ansible (Инвентарь)

apt-get update && apt-get install -y ansible sshpass chown -R root:user /etc/ansible chmod -R 774 /etc/ansible cd /etc/ansible pwd ls vim inventory vim ansible.cfg Вносим следующие изменения:Инвентарь должен располагаться по пути /etc/ansible/inventory
Отключите проверку SSH–ключа на хосте cd /etc/ansible mkdir group_vars Опишем переменные для каждой группы в соответствующих файлах:Должны быть следующие файлы, со следующими значениями
Оглавление

ADMIN-DT:

  • Установим пакет ansible:

apt-get update && apt-get install -y ansible sshpass

  • Назначем необходимые права на директорию /etc/ansible:

chown -R root:user /etc/ansible

chmod -R 774 /etc/ansible

  • Из  под обычного пользователя user пероходим для дальнейшей работы в директорию /etc/ansible:

cd /etc/ansible

pwd

ls

  • Создаём инвентарный файл:

vim inventory

  • Редактируем конфигурационный файл ansible.cfg:

vim ansible.cfg

Вносим следующие изменения:Инвентарь должен располагаться по пути /etc/ansible/inventory
Отключите проверку SSH–ключа на хосте

ADMIN-DT:

  • Из  под обычного пользователя user пероходим для дальнейшей работы в директорию /etc/ansible:

cd /etc/ansible

  • Создадим директорию для описания групповых переменных, которые будут использоваться для подключения по SSH:

mkdir group_vars

Опишем переменные для каждой группы в соответствующих файлах:Должны быть следующие файлы, со следующими значениями

-2
-3